Considering most garage doors have a starting weight of around 130 pounds, it’s safe to say that garage door cables serve an essential purpose when it comes to the safe operation of your garage door. Don’t try to use your garage door if the cables snap. If you keep operating it, you’ll put additional strain on other parts of the door, including its tracks and rollers. 30 years Your Garage Door Should Serve You Well for Decades A modern garage door's original panels should last at least 30 years before replacement makes its way onto your to-do list. Garage door openers, on the other hand, will last between 10 and 15 years.
